Hostaway Integration

7 min. readlast update: 03.25.2024

Touch Stay integrates with Hostaway to import your properties and then automate the sending of invitations for confirmed resertations.

undefined

The steps to complete your integration:

  • Step 1: Connect your Touch Stay & Hostaway accounts
  • Step 2: Match Hostaway properties
  • Step 3: Import Hostaway properties
  • Step 4: Complete guide creation (new Touch Stay customers only)
  • Step 5: Personalisation settings
  • Step 6: Sync reservations
  • Step 7: Sharing guide links through Hostaway

Step 1. Connect your accounts

First, you need to authorise your Touch Stay account with Hostaway. Go to the Integrations page in your Touch Stay account, go to the Partners tab and click “Connect” underneath the Hostaway logo.

Next, in a separate browser tab or window login to Hostaway and navigate to the Settings from the left hand menu and then select Hostaway API. Here you will create a public API key and add that to Touch Stay (you can find more information about Hostaway API keys in this article).

undefined

  • Click on Create
  • Give your API key a name (e.g. “Touch Stay”)
  • Click Create once more
  • Copy and paste both the Account ID and API Key into the boxes in the Touch Stay connection screen. Hostaway will show the key only once, make sure to copy and paste it before closing the window!

undefined

 

Step 2. Match Properties

Once authorised, you can match any existing Touch Stay guides to your Hostaway listings. Go to the Match tab on the Integrations page.

Use the drop-downs to select the correct Hostaway listing for each Touch Stay guide. When complete, click “Match Selected”. If you don’t have any to match, then just click “Skip” without choosing any Hostaway listings. If you don’t see any guides on this step then they are already matched and you can move on to Step 3.

 

Step 3. Import Properties

If you have any remaining unmatched listings from Hostaway then the next screen allows you to import those into Touch Stay.

Go to the Import tab on the Integrations page. Check the ones you want to import and click the “Import Selected” button. If you don’t want to import any, or don’t have any remaining, then just click “Skip” whilst leaving the selections blank.

Touch Stay will import the following:

  • Property Name
  • Property Address
  • Cover photo

Each unit imported will create a new Touch Stay guide.

Step 4. Complete guide creation (new Touch Stay customers only)

Matching or importing listings won’t automatically start syncing reservations from Hostaway, so now is the time to check the content of your guides and make sure they’re ready before you sync reservations with Hostaway.

If you’re new to Touch Stay then check out the Getting Started page for hints and tips on the quickest way to build out your welcome book content.

 

Step 5. Personalisation settings

You can connect custom field codes created in Touch Stay to additional fields through the Hostaway integration. This will then mean any values/data for these fields in Hostaway will pass into Touch Stay and can be added to your guide or Memo message templates. The available fields are as follows:

  • Door code (data type: Text)
  • Check-in Time (data type: Number)
  • Check-out Time (data type: Number)
  • Hostaway Email (data type: Text), when added as the reply-to email in your Memo templates any replies will go to your Hostaway inbox
  • Channel Reservation ID (data type: Text)
  • Hostaway Reservation ID (data type: Text)
  • Guest first name
  • Guest last name
  • Arrival date
  • Departure date
  • Guest contact phone number*
  • Guest contact email address*

*Some OTAs and booking sites do not always provide the guest email address or phone number so the availability of these two data points are dependent on the platform the guest used to complete their booking.

To connect any of these fields to Touch Stay head to the Custom data mapping tab on the Integrations page and click the “+ Add new mapping” button.

From here you can select the Hostaway field to connect, choose a name for your custom field code and any substitute value. Substitute values are used in the case of data missing when the field code is used, see this article for more detail about field codes.  

Once the custom fields have been created, then any future reservations which sync from Hostaway will have the relevant data automatically populated on the invitation record.

 

Step 6. Sync reservations

Once your guides are ready then you can start syncing with Hostaway.

Go to the Sync reservations tab on the Integration page. Select the guides you want to sync using the checkboxes.

Use the “Select All” option at the top right of the page to select all in one go. Click Sync selected to submit.

Here you can choose whether to import all your future reservations or have Touch Stay only import new reservations. 

  • If you are new to Touch Stay then choose the “All reservations” option
  • If you are already using Memo, Touch Stay's guest messaging tool, before you connect your Hostaway ccount then it's st to choose the option “New reservations only” to prevent duplicate reservations being imported.

Next, select the guides to start syncing by using the checkboxes (note the “Select All” option at the bottom left) and click Submit.

If you have selected “All reservations” then all your future dated reservations from Hostaway will now be imported and will generate invitations and schedule email or SMS messages based on the reservation details and your Touch Stay message template schedules. All future reservations for guides with the sync active will also now be imported automatically. 

Step 7. Sharing guide links through Hostaway

Touch Stay sends the unique link for each reservation back to Hostaway. You can then add this to any Hostaway message templates and automate the sending of the guide link through the Hostaway unified inbox.  

Your Hostaway account will have a new custom field created for Reservations called {{reservation_touch_stay_guide_link}}. 

In the Hostaway message template screen, place your cursor where you would like the guide link to go and then click on the icon at the top right corner of the message template box:

undefined

Next, find the {{reservation_touch_stay_guide_link}} custom field in the column for “Reservation custom fields” and click on it to drop it into your message:

undefined

And that’s it! Simply use the above to add the link to your Hostaway message templates as part of your communication flow with your guests.

Warning:  Do not delete the {{reservation_touch_stay_guide_link}} custom field in the Hostaway Custom Fields page. If you delete it, you will need to contact Touch Stay support to have it added back in.

Notes:

A note about Hostaway message timing

There will be a slight delay between the booking arriving in Hostaway and the link being sent back from Touch Stay whilst our respective systems process the booking, generate the link and pass it back. Therefore we recommend NOT adding the {{reservation_touch_stay_guide_link}} custom field to Hostaway messages that are sent out as soon as the booking is received. Instead, we recommend adding a message ~1 hour later or perhaps the next day that's dedicated to introducing guests to everything they'll find in your guide book.

What happens if I’m already using Memo?

If you’re already using Memo but want to now change to using Hostaway to send the links then you would need to archive the relevant Memo message templates. This prevents them from being added to any future reservations that come in and you can then activate a new message flow in Hostaway. See this article for more details about archiving your Memo message templates. Note that archiving message templates won’t affect any existing invitations, if you want to cancel any Memo messages that are already scheduled then that will need to delete the template instead. 

 

Was this article helpful?